A Blast from the Past

Now, let’s hop into our trivia time machine. Did you know that back in the roaring ’80s, mortgage rates were more like a roar of a lion—the average rate was soaring above 10%, and would you believe it once hit a whopping 18% in 1981? Sounds cray, but it’s true! Fast forward to today, and today’s rate is chillin’ like a villain in comparison, which means you’re in the driver’s seat.

Oh, and here’s a fun nugget for your next party: while you’re cozy in your home with a 30-year term,( you could pay nearly double the home’s sale price in interest over the life of the loan—now that’s a jaw-dropper! But don’t fret; throw a little extra dough at those payments when you can, and you’ll cut down on that interest like a hot knife through butter.

What is prime rate vs mortgage rate?

– Prime rate vs. mortgage rate – it’s a bit like comparing apples to oranges. The prime rate’s the benchmark for short-term loans and credit cards, while the mortgage rate is your long-term home loan buddy. Both important, just different flavors of the financial fruit basket.

What is the lowest 30-year mortgage rate ever recorded?

– History buffs, gather ’round! The lowest recorded 30-year mortgage rate ever was a jaw-dropping 2.65% back in December 2020. Makes you wanna build a time machine, doesn’t it?

Why did my mortgage go up if I have a fixed rate?

– Got a fixed rate and your mortgage still crept up? It’s probably not your loan’s actual interest rate – that stays put. What might’ve nudged up could be things like property taxes or insurance premiums. Always those little gremlins in the details!
